Sesame Chicken Salad Recipe
  • Prep/Total Time: 15 min.
  • Yield: 2 Servings
15 15

Ingredients

  • 1/3 cup fat-free mayonnaise
  • 1 tablespoon reduced-sodium soy sauce
  • 1/8 teaspoon ground ginger
  • 1-1/3 cups cubed cooked chicken breast
  • 1/2 cup chopped fresh snow peas
  • 1 small sweet red pepper, chopped
  • 1 tablespoon sesame seeds, toasted
  • 4 lettuce leaves
  • 1 tablespoon chopped cashews

Directions

  • In a small bowl, combine the mayonnaise, soy sauce and ginger. Stir in the chicken, peas, pepper and sesame seeds. Serve over lettuce leaves; sprinkle with cashews. Yield: 2 servings.

Nutritional Facts 1 cup salad with 1-1/2 teaspoons cashews equals 254 calories, 8 g fat (2 g saturated fat), 76 mg cholesterol, 736 mg sodium, 14 g carbohydrate, 4 g fiber, 31 g protein. Diabetic Exchanges: 4 lean meat, 1 vegetable, 1 fat, 1/2 starch.

Originally published as Sesame Chicken Salad in Healthy Cooking April/May 2009, p63
